Ford Explorer Trim Detachment Recall: Do Vehicles Qualify for a Lemon Law Claim? (2024)

Ford Motor Company announced a significant recall for 2011-2019 Ford Explorer vehicles in early January 2024. This recall, identified by NHTSA Recall No. 24V-031 and Ford’s internal Recall No. 24S02, involves nearly 1.9 million vehicles. The primary concern is that the A-pillar exterior trim on these vehicles may detach while driving, posing a potential road hazard.

Ford Explorer Recall Overview

Safety Recall Details:

Manufacturer: Ford Motor Company
Submission Date: January 19, 2024
NHTSA Recall No.: 24V-031
Manufacturer Recall No.: 24S02
Potentially Affected Vehicles: 1,889,110
Estimated Defective Percentage: 5%
Vehicle Model Years: 2011-2019 Ford Explorer

Vehicle Defect and Issues

The A-pillar trim, which is the exterior trim molding piece bordering the windshield, may detach due to improper assembly or repair. This can create a road hazard, increasing the risk of a crash. The recall affects vehicles produced between May 17, 2010, and March 3, 2019.

Chronology of Claims Reported:

The Office of Defects Investigation (ODI) launched PE23-001 on January 27, 2023, to examine claims of A-pillar trim panel detachment in 2011-2019 Ford Explorer models after receiving 164 owner complaints. The number of complaints has since risen to 671, including reports of a crash and two injuries. Some failures occurred at highway speeds, causing the trim to obstruct trailing vehicles.

Ford’s April 17, 2023, report to ODI cited 175 complaints and 14,162 warranty claims, attributing the defect to issues like faulty installation and damaged fasteners. As a result, Ford issued recall 24V-031 on January 19, 2024, to inspect and replace the trim panels with added adhesive.

Safety Concerns and Risks

A detached A-pillar trim can fall off while driving. If a structure detachment occurs, it can become a road hazard for other vehicles. This increases the likelihood of accidents as other drivers may need to take evasive actions to avoid the debris.

Ford’s Remedy Program

Under Ford recalls and their customer satisfaction programs vehicles will be inspected and repaired as necessary. Authorized dealers will provide the inspection for A-pillar applique trim clip attachments that are not properly engaged or may be missing.

Particularly, the affected vehicles will undergo repairs involving a A-pillar trim replacement with added adhesive. Ford states, repairs including labor and parts will be provided free of charge, when parts are available. Owners will be notified via mail between March 13-25, 2024. Dealers were notified earlier, on January 22, 2024, to ensure they are prepared for the influx of affected vehicles.

Lemon Law Implications

Despite this recall, owners of 2011-2019 Ford Explorers may still qualify for a lemon law claim, especially if your vehicle has had repeated issues or has spent significant time in the shop for repairs. This means if your vehicle’s persistent problems go beyond the repairs performed for the Ford Explorer recall issue, you may still be eligible for compensation under lemon law.

If you face ongoing problems, consider pursuing a lemon law claim to protect your rights as a consumer. Lemon law criteria vary by state, with some states having specific timeframes for when issues must occur for a vehicle to qualify.
